\n" ); document.write( "\n" ); document.write( "The Question says:
\n" ); document.write( "Simplify: ((x^2-9)/(x+1)) / ((x+3)/(x^2-1))
\n" ); document.write( "(its written as a fraction divided by the second as a fraction)\r
\n" ); document.write( "\n" ); document.write( "I know the first thing to do is flip the second fraction and then multiply, so I did this and got: (x^2-9)(x^2-1) over (x+1)(x+3). I then FOILed the top and bottom to get: (x^4-10x^2+9) over (x^2 +4x +3). Then I thought I could reduce to: x^4-9x^2+6 over 4x. This answer is wrong. \r
\n" ); document.write( "\n" ); document.write( "The solution in the book is exactly this:
\n" ); document.write( "((x^2-9)/(x+1)) / ((x+3)/(x^2-1)) = ((x+3)(x-3)/(x+1))*((x+1)(x-1)/(x+3))=(x-3)(x-1)=x^2-4x+3. \r
\n" ); document.write( "\n" ); document.write( "I'm not following the steps that the book used to come up with this answer, and am wondering why my approach is incorrect. Thank You for your help!\r
